[PATCH v2] powerpc/ptdump: Fix sparse warning in hashpagetable.c

As reported by sparse: arch/powerpc/mm/ptdump/hashpagetable.c:264:29: warning: restricted __be64 degrades to integer arch/powerpc/mm/ptdump/hashpagetable.c:265:49: warning: restricted __be64 degrades to integer arch/powerpc/mm/ptdump/hashpagetable.c:267:36: warning: incorrect type in assignment (different base types) arch/powerpc/mm/ptdump/hashpagetable.c:267:36: expected unsigned long long [usertype] arch/powerpc/mm/ptdump/hashpagetable.c:267:36: got restricted __be64 [usertype] v arch/powerpc/mm/ptdump/hashpagetable.c:268:36: warning: incorrect type in assignment (different base types) arch/powerpc/mm/ptdump/hashpagetable.c:268:36: expected unsigned long long [usertype] arch/powerpc/mm/ptdump/hashpagetable.c:268:36: got restricted __be64 [usertype] r The values returned by plpar_pte_read_4() are CPU endian, not __be64, so assigning them to struct hash_pte confuses sparse. As a minimal fix open code a struct to hold the values with CPU endian types.
